activity多实例任务节点审批
前言
在上一篇,我们演示了如何基于组任务进行审批,其实从任务分类上看,属于单实例任务,即每个审批节点只有一个任务实例,为什么这么说呢?
这就要说到activity的多实例任务了。activity对于单个审批节点来说,可能存在需要多个审批人的场景,即只有多个人审批完毕这个节点才算结束,通俗来说,就是我们熟悉的会签(多个人审批通过)以及或签(某个人审批通过),下面我们来演示一下这种场景的使用
1、定义流程文件
这里需要说明的是,节点的其他定义都类似,但是配置某个节点为多实例的时候,需要配置的地方如图中所示,即Multiinstance的地方,第一个参数表示这些任务是否按顺序会签,第二个参数设置是实例的任务个数,即当流程启动了以后task表中对应的当前节点产生的任务个数,后续我们可以通过观察数据表的数据变化进行分析;
2、部署并启动流程实例
public static void main(String[] args) {ProcessEngine processEngine = ProcessEngines.getDefaultProcessEngine();RepositoryServi
activity多实例任务节点审批相关推荐
- activity多实例任务减签
前言 加签或减签的操作在多实例任务节点中是经常遇见的,举例来说,某个审批节点配置了5个人审批,但是其中某个人因为特殊的原因无法进行审批了怎么办?这时候就需要用到减签的操作了 下面我们通过一个简单的案例 ...
- workflow java_workflow java实现的activity工作流实例 Develop 238万源代码下载- www.pudn.com...
文件名称: workflow下载 收藏√ [ 5 4 3 2 1 ] 开发工具: Java 文件大小: 134 KB 上传时间: 2014-09-18 下载次数: 3 提 供 者: 张华 详 ...
- [Android实例] 同一Activity的实例被多次重复创建
如此这般配置即可. 在AndroidManifest.xml文件中 <activity android:name="com.lxXxxxyActivity&qu ...
- 在Activity启动过程中如何任务栈的栈顶是否是将要启动的Activity的实例
我们在ActivityStack类中可以看到某个方法用于返回当前任务栈顶端的ActivityRecord对象,如果栈是空的,就返回null,ActivityRecord用于代表在历史任务栈中的一个Ac ...
- Activity实现 高亮显示活动节点,和所有已完成过的节点
2019独角兽企业重金招聘Python工程师标准>>> 上面这种是显示当前活动节点,下面我将贴出 显示所有已完成过的节点,第二种显示有问题,如图像不清晰,中文乱码,而且流程图感觉失真 ...
- mysql父子节点分层_mysql 递归实例 父子节点层级递归
在Oracle中可以使用CONNECT BY子句可以轻松的实现递归查询,在MSSQLServer和DB2中则可以使用WITH子句来实现递归查询,MYSQL中即不支持CONNECT BY子句也不支持 ...
- Activity工作流 修改当前节点审批人节点改派
支持当前结点有多个审核人 其中一个审核人要流转给另外的人 其他审核人不受影响 ProcessEngine processEngine = ProcessEngines.getDefaultProces ...
- activiti绘制流程图,线上显示文字,审批过的节点添加审批人的名字
最有时间优化了一下activiti的绘制图片工具类,主要用于在领导审批的时候展示的漂亮,直接上代码吧, /** 放在我们的业务代码中,穿个流程实例id进来,返回一个字符数组,然后该怎么处理你们应该知道 ...
- 工作流-flowable 之驳回 多实例驳回 并行网关驳回 普通节点驳回到多实例
6.4.0 新增加了驳回的方式,真是对中国式流程的一种福音呀,感谢flowable创始人. 再也不为开发驳回流程发愁了,网上那些视频和修改源码真的是demo级别的,不能商业用. 只有心如流水的学习才是 ...
- Android移动APP开发笔记——Cordova(PhoneGap)通过CordovaPlugin插件调用 Activity 实例...
引言 Cordova(PhoneGap)採用的是HTML5+JavaScript混合模式来开发移动手机APP.因此当页面须要获取手机内部某些信息时(比如:联系人信息,坐标定位.短信等),程序就须要调用 ...
最新文章
- C++ with STL(五)queuestacklist
- 运筹学两阶段法编程c语言,运筹学上机实验 - 单纯形方法的两阶段法
- 前端开发周边(js版页内锚点跳转方法)
- win10 中的eclipse无法新建web项目
- 【JavaEE】WebService到底是什么?
- vmstat命令使用
- 挣值管理:PV,AC和EV
- [置顶] 自己动手写Web容器之TomJetty之六:动态页面引入
- 圣诞节吃饺子时,怎么给女票解释啥是AI?
- css放服务器ttf文件格式,CSS如何实现读取服务器字体
- IntelliJ IDEA 自定义控制台输出多颜色格式功能 --- 安装Grep Console插件
- matlab imresize
- docker compose安装_docker stack,docker-compose前世今生
- 绘图的尺寸_Auto CAD机械绘图尺寸标注教程10(标注多重引线)
- 20220117 matlab 全局变量调试
- 微软bi报表服务器,什么是 Power BI 报表服务器?
- Unbuntu16.04下cmake-gui安装
- uniapp swiper waterfall同用 tabbar页面卡顿
- QT 交叉编译 ARM / CSKY
- 002 - new javascript 基础
热门文章
- ThingJS如何收费的?
- 计算机应届生面试招聘自我介绍,计算机应届生面试英文自我介绍
- 47页数字孪生人脸识别轨迹分析电子围栏智慧工地解决方案
- matlab中ones()、inf用法
- 基于51单片机交通灯控制器(东西通行_南北通行_按键启动)
- 李大潜院士:学习数学是战略性投资
- 新闻文本分类学习笔记
- 论文:OIE@OIA: an Adaptable and Efficient Open Information Extraction Framework
- c语言函数max 的作用,C语言问题—max()函数
- android ios mp4格式转换,ios 开发 视频格式转换、mov转MP4